On 12/5/25 05:18, Alyssa Ross wrote:
> Demi Marie Obenour <demiobenour@gmail.com> writes:
> 
>> On 12/4/25 10:04, Alyssa Ross wrote:
>>> We don't really care about these groups, but if they don't exist, udev
>>> will also not apply the "other" modes from rules, leaving
>>> e.g. /dev/kvm root-only when it should be globally read/write.
>>>
>>> tty is set to 5, conforming with the systemd convention.
>>>
>>> Link: https://systemd.io/UIDS-GIDS/
>>> Signed-off-by: Alyssa Ross <hi@alyssa.is>
>>> ---
>>> Demi, this should avoid the need to add a udev rule for /dev/kvm.
>>>
>>>  host/rootfs/image/etc/group | 14 ++++++++++++++
>>>  1 file changed, 14 insertions(+)
>>>
>>> diff --git a/host/rootfs/image/etc/group b/host/rootfs/image/etc/group
>>> index 18acc30..e3ade46 100644
>>> --- a/host/rootfs/image/etc/group
>>> +++ b/host/rootfs/image/etc/group
>>> @@ -1 +1,15 @@
>>>  root:x:0:root
>>> +clock:x:1:
>>> +dialout:x:2:
>>> +kmem:x:3:
>>> +input:x:4:
>>> +tty:x:5:
>>> +video:x:6:
>>> +render:x:7:
>>> +sgx:x:8:
>>
>> Do we even need this?  SGX needs userspace tools that Spectrum
>> doesn't have.  I presume that the need for this will go away once
>> Spectrum's host is built without SGX.
> 
> I think it's better to have it, because without it udev will continue to
> warn about it when it reads the default rules.  This happens regardless
> of whether a matching device actually exists.

Ah, I missed that part.  Then keep it.
